Five years after the New York Yankees traded for Joey Gallo from the Texas Rangers, the transaction's outcome is clear. The Yankees acquired Gallo in July 2021 for four prospects as they sought a postseason push, but he struggled significantly. Gallo's time in New York included a batting average of just.159 over 140 games, leading to a 2022 trade to the Los Angeles Dodgers. Meanwhile, the Rangers' return has proven beneficial, with Ezequiel Duran and Josh Smith contributing positively to the team's performance. Smith was a breakout player in 2024, while Duran has emerged strongly in 2026. The assessment of the trade presents the Yankees with an F and the Rangers with an A- grade.

"This time five years ago, the New York Yankees were chasing a postseason spot and looking for a left-handed power bat, while the Texas Rangers were at the bottom of the AL West and looking to turn established pieces into prospect capital. The result was one of the biggest deals of the 2021 trade deadline, with the Rangers sending All-Star slugger Joey Gallo and reliever Joely Rodriguez to the Yankees in exchange for four prospects: Ezequiel Duran, Josh Smith, Glenn Otto, and Trevor Hauver.
